In M m -, DR. EDWIN C. BURKE With the passing of Dr. Edwin C. Burke, the Church of the Nazarene lost one of her most prominent and influential lay leaders. In 1916, Dr. Burke was elected a member of the Board of Trustees of Olivet Nazarene Col- lege and continued in this capacity until his death, thereby completing a career of most able leader- ship of twenty-eight years as a member, twenty- six of which he served as Chairman. OF TRUSTEES Olivet Naznrene College is a co-educational institu- tion of the Church of the Nazarene and is governed by a PJoard of Trustees composed of iifty-six ministers. district superintendents, and la} ' men from the seven states of the Central Educational Zone. The student bod} ' usually sees this group cii masse only once a }-ear, but the} ' know that the individual members of the board continually bear the weight of their responsibili- ties to the college. It is through their faitliful guidance and counsel that Olivet has moved forw ard in Eiluca- tion With A Christian PuriDose . Olivet owes a special debt of gratitude to those mem- bers who have given tw(j decades or more of loyalt} ' , being instant in adversity as well as in prosperity. Rev. C. L. Bradley and Dr. E. O. Chalfant are the senior members in years of service. They have been on the board for twenty-seven years. Dr. C. A. Gibson, next in seniority, has served twenty years. ariam DR. LAURENCE H. HOWE In his earlier years Dr. Laurence H. Howe was active in the administration of the college, serving as vice-president and also taking an active part in alumni activities and sponsoring student organ- izations. Failing in health in the last few years made it necessary for him to drop many of these activities. At the time of his death, he was pro- fessor of historical theology. Dr. Howe graduated from Olivet Nazarene College in 1921 and received his B.D. from Mc- Cormack Seminary in 1931. He received his doc- tor of divinity degree at Olivet in 1939. Prior to returning to Olivet in 1932 as a mem- ber of the faculty he was pastor of Nazarene churches at Racine, Wisconsin, Harvey, Illinois, and Elgin, Illinois. . L p.
